- recover verb - Definition, pictures, pronunciation and usage notes . . .
Definition of recover verb from the Oxford Advanced Learner's Dictionary [intransitive] to get well again after being ill, hurt, etc recover from something He's still recovering from his operation She spent many weeks in hospital recovering from her injuries He has fully recovered from the shoulder surgery
- recover verb - Definition, pictures, pronunciation and usage notes . . .
Definition of recover verb from the Oxford Advanced American Dictionary [intransitive] recover (from something) to get well again after being sick, hurt, etc He's still recovering from his operation

- recovered adjective - Definition, pictures, pronunciation and usage . . .
Definition of recovered adjective from the Oxford Advanced Learner's Dictionary recovered (from something) in good health and well again after being ill, hurt, etc She is now fully recovered from her injuries The Oxford Learner’s Thesaurus explains the difference between groups of similar words
- RECOVER | definition in the Cambridge English Dictionary
recover from He never really recovered from the shock of his wife dying to become successful or normal again after being damaged or having problems : recover after It took a long time for the economy to recover after the slump
